We have quite a few gators in Fork, most in Little Caney.
It is not unusual to see several in a day in Little Caney, mostly from boat ramp to the back by the bridge.
(Most I've counted in one day was 9, largest around 12 feet).
If this was a legal harvest, the alligator had to have been hooked on private property, pulled ashore, then dispatched.

Amazing how little perspective people have for size when they see a gator. They all LOOK huge. Kept hearing about a 20' gator at Squaw Creek. Wow! A new world record for an american alligator right here in Glen Rose(old record 19' from Louisiana years ago). Then that one swims up next to my boat in the same creek people report the giant living and it looks big...about 8'-9' big. Imagination
